Standard Job DescriptionSenior Asset Management Assistant Organizational Setting and Work Relationships The Senior Asset Management Assistant will perform asset management functions in accordance with the prevailing rules and regulations pertaining to management of Property, Plant and Equipment (PPE). The incumbent is normally supervised by an Asset Management Officer/Associate who defines the work objectives and provides regular advice and guidance. The contacts of the incumbent will include providing operational assistance to Field Operations for management of their assets focusing particularly on supporting disposal of assets. Hence, the incumbent will have regular contacts with Field Operations, Asset Management Unit and other HQ entities. The Senior Asset Management Assistant may also have contacts with external counterparts such as auctioneers and other service providers. Furthermore, the incumbent will assist the Asset Management team to monitor and report on asset management issues. Duties - Organize the administration of assets auctions in order to be completed in a manner that maximizes revenue for UNHCR. - Take part in frequent assets disposal and set-up missions within the Area of Responsibility (AoR). - Facilitate identification, assessment and selection of vendors (Auctioneer) within the AoR, based on their capability for delivering the best services and cost effectiveness to UNHCR. - Liaise with UNHCR operations to ensure vehicle accidents and damage are reported and processed in accordance with the prevailing Asset Management rules and regulations. - Report on income from sale of assets in cooperation with relevant counterparts. - Coordinate with the operations and maintain an efficient system for the resolution of asset management issues in support of UNHCR's users. - Assist with the coordination of asset management activities to ensure that UNHCR's assets are repaired through effective application of the GFM insurance provisions. - Maintain accurate and comprehensive records on asset management activities and provide reports as and whenever requested. - Analyse disposal requisitions to ensure that specifications, disposal dates and other requirements are in order. - Assist in the evaluation of service providers and provide advice to UNHCR operations on asset disposals. - Prepare or assist with the preparation of Transfers of Ownership, Disposals, etc. in order to streamline the asset disposal process in relevant systems. - Monitor the quality and accuracy of asset-related data in the relevant business systems. - Compile and analyse statistical information in asset-related matters assisting the development of plans and adequate decision making. - Implement effective asset management, regularly monitor the asset/fleet pool, in order to save cost and safeguard the investment of the Organisation. - Facilitating receipt, inspection, registration & marking of PPE and provide support with the organisation of their physical verification. - Draft of Right of Use and Transfer of Ownership agreements for signature, if requested. - Draft disposal forms and cases for the Asset Management Board and organise the disposal of PPE complying with Asset Management Board decisions. - Monitor the compliance of operations with relevant UNHCR regulations, rules and procedures related to asset management. Report non-compliance to the supervisor. - With oversight from the supervisor liaise with UNHCR offices on the disposal methodology to ensure that vehicle assets are mandatorily sold after five-year usage period. - Perform other related duties as required. The Global Fleet Management UNHCR Field Offices and operations provide, safe, professional, and cost-effective fleet management services and solutions to support optimum program delivery. We are committed to provide practical guidance to field operations on the operation and management of UNHCR vehicles, support humanitarian civil servants working with UNHCR vehicles and fleet operations, while delivering the Organization’s mandate of providing protection to forcibly displaced and stateless people.
Global Fleet management Section adapts proactive management approach of UNHCR’s vehicle assets, which may include light vehicles, heavy vehicles, specialist vehicles and motorcycles. Fleet management covers a range of functions, including vehicle procurement and financing, vehicle maintenance, vehicles telematics (tracking and diagnostics), driver and personnel management, speed management, fuel management, and health and safety management.
The section provides centralized fleet management model to UNHCR, empowering the Organization move beyond simply operating vehicles on a country-by-country and project-by-project basis to actively planning for optimizing vehicle fleet capacity and efficiency on a global scale.
